Why is CCIV Moving?

While CCIV stock is slightly down to start the day, it looks to rise just before a merger with Lucid Motors. The stock symbol will change to LCID, and the merger allows Lucid to take on Tesla. In fact, many are calling Lucid—an all-electric car firm—the Next Tesla or the Tesla Killer.
